-------------------------------- USAGE-SPECIFIC PART
test :: A
test = bottomUp @F trf $ ABC (BA (ABC B (CB B))) (CB B)
class F a where
trf :: a -> a
instance F B where
trf b = b
instance F C where
trf c = CD D
type instance AppSelector F A = 'False
type instance AppSelector F B = 'True
type instance AppSelector F C = 'True
type instance AppSelector F D = 'False
type instance AppSelector F E = 'False
topDownTrav :: forall c b . ClassyPlate c b => (forall a . (ClassyPlate c a, c a) => a -> a) -> b -> b
{-# INLINE topDownTrav #-}
topDownTrav trf = descend @c (topDownTrav @c trf . trf)
bottomUpTrav :: forall c b . ClassyPlate c b => (forall a . (ClassyPlate c a, c a) => a -> a) -> b -> b
{-# INLINE bottomUpTrav #-}
bottomUpTrav trf = descend @c (trf . bottomUpTrav @c trf)
--------
test2 = bottomUpM @Debug debugCs $ ABC (BA (ABC B (CB B))) (CD D)
class Debug a where
debugCs :: a -> IO a
instance Debug C where
debugCs c = print c >> return c
type instance AppSelector Debug a = DebugSelector a
type family DebugSelector t where
DebugSelector C = 'True
DebugSelector _ = 'False
--------
test3 :: A
test3 = bottomUp @(MonoMatch C) (monoApp (\c -> case c of CB b -> CB (BA (ABC b (CB B))); CD d -> CD D)) $ ABC (BA (ABC B (CB B))) (CB B)
-------
class DebugWhere a where
debugWhereCs :: a -> IO a
debugSubtree :: a -> Bool
debugSubtree _ = True
instance DebugWhere C where
debugWhereCs c = print c >> return c
instance DebugWhere D where
debugWhereCs c = return c
debugSubtree _ = False
instance DebugWhere E where
debugWhereCs c = error "Should never go here" >> return c
type instance AppSelector DebugWhere a = DebugWhereSelector a
type family DebugWhereSelector t where
DebugWhereSelector C = 'True
DebugWhereSelector D = 'True
DebugWhereSelector E = 'True
DebugWhereSelector _ = 'False
test4 = selectiveTraverseM @DebugWhere (\e -> (, debugSubtree e) <$> debugWhereCs e) $ ABC (BA (ABC B (CB B))) (CD (DDE D E))
